Output babbdf743c81f014f6b03d87a8439860691dfa6a0283da8f66375620bd904980:4

value
2499876
script pubkey
OP_0 OP_PUSHBYTES_20 79d317c8e306d418b6727d0522a3476239865dfa
address
bc1q08f30j8rqm2p3dnj05zj9g68vgucvh06fc346p
transaction
babbdf743c81f014f6b03d87a8439860691dfa6a0283da8f66375620bd904980
spent
true